Home  >  Environmental Protection  >  Conservation Reserve Enhancement Program (CREP)

This program is a partnership between the USDA Farm Service Agency, Wisconsin Department of Agriculture, Trade and Consumer Protection, USDA, Natural Resources Conservation Service, the Wisconsin Department of Natural Resources, and participating county land conservation departments throughout the state.

It is an opportunity for Wisconsin landowners to enroll agricultural lands into various practices. Practices include riparian buffers, wetland restoration and establishment of native grassland areas, among others. There is no waiting period for this program, and there is no competition with other applicants; however, enrollment and eligibility determinations are on a first-come, first-serve basis.
